No Doan, no problem; D-backs peg ASU’s Bobby Hurley for 1st pitch

After it was announced Coyotes legend Shane Doan would not be able to throw out the ceremonial first pitch Friday, the D-backs are bringing in Bobby Hurley.

The Arizona Diamondbacks had a solid plan for their ceremonial first pitch to christen the new season at Chase Field on Friday.

Joining in the celebration with the rest of the Valley, the D-backs called Arizona Coyotes legend Shane Doan to step up to the mound when the D-backs take on the Red Sox.

Add in the fact that it’s the 2019 season and Doan wore No. 19 with the ‘Yotes — a jersey retired this season by the team — and it was only fitting for the Captain to throw the first pitch.

Unfortunately for all parties involved, the D-backs announced Tuesday that the right winger would not be able to make it to the ballpark as he has family commitments to attend.

Luckily for the D-backs, they had a solid second option waiting in the wings in Arizona State head coach Bobby Hurley.

Fresh off a season in which the Sun Devils knocked off then-No. 1 seed Kansas, swept in-state rival Arizona, compiled a 23-11 record and reached the NCAA Tournament for a second consecutive time, Hurley will don the D-backs’ threads and look for the zone.

But this isn’t Hurley’s first rodeo with tossing out the first pitch.

In 2015, Hurley threw out the ceremonial first pitch before the D-backs took on the Chicago Cubs.
